安卓开发个人APP开发

在移动互联网时代,手机已成为人们生活中必不可少的工具。越来越多的人选择使用智能手机来满足他们的各种需求,这也促使了APP市场的快速发展。而在APP市场中,安卓系统占据着绝大多数的份额,因此安卓开发成为一个热门行业。

二、安卓开发的优势

相比于其他系统,安卓系统在开发上更为开放、灵活,给开发者提供了更多的自由。开发一个个人APP也不再是难以企及的梦想,只需要一台电脑和一些基本的编程知识,就可以开始开发自己的APP。而且安卓系统拥有庞大的用户群体和完善的应用商店,开发者可以更加轻松地推广和发布自己的APP。

三、安卓开发的挑战

虽然安卓开发有着诸多优势,但也面临着一些挑战。安卓系统的碎片化问题让开发者需要考虑适配不同的设备和系统版本,增加了开发的难度和工作量。由于APP市场竞争激烈,开发者需要具备创意和差异化的产品来吸引用户。开发一个APP还需要考虑到用户体验、功能完善性、安全性等多个方面,这对开发者的技术和综合能力提出了更高的要求。

四、个人APP开发的前景

随着智能手机的普及和人们对APP的需求不断增加,个人APP开发作为一个新兴的创业方向具有巨大的潜力。越来越多的人将会尝试开发自己的APP,满足自己的特定需求。个人APP开发也可以成为一种副业或兼职,为个人创造更多的收入来源。

五、个人APP开发的建议

对于想要从事个人APP开发的人来说,首先需要具备一定的编程基础,如Java、Kotlin等编程语言的掌握。要积极学习新技术,紧跟行业的发展趋势。第三,要从用户的角度出发,注重用户体验和功能设计,提供有价值的产品。要善于与人沟通合作,与其他开发者互相学习交流,提升自己的技术水平和软实力。

安卓开发个人APP开发是一个具有潜力和机遇的行业。在这个行业中,开发者可以通过自己的努力和创意,实现个人的梦想和价值。开发者也要面对挑战和竞争,不断提升自己的技术和能力。只有不断学习和创新,才能在个人APP开发领域中获得成功。

安卓开发从入门到精通

一、入门篇

安卓开发是指基于安卓操作系统的应用程序开发。安卓操作系统是目前最流行的移动操作系统之一,因其开源、免费、灵活等优势而备受开发者青睐。想要开始学习安卓开发,首先需要掌握Java编程语言和基本的编程概念。Java是安卓开发的主要语言,掌握Java编程语言对于后续的学习和开发工作至关重要。了解面向对象编程、变量、循环、条件语句等基本概念,以及掌握Java的语法和常见的类库和API是入门的基础。

二、环境搭建

在入门阶段,需要配置好安卓开发环境。首先需要下载并安装Java Development Kit(JDK),然后安装Android Studio,这是一个官方提供的集成开发环境(IDE),它包含了安卓开发所需的各种工具和资源。在Android Studio中,可以创建、编写、调试和发布安卓应用程序。还需下载和配置安卓SDK(Software Development Kit),这是一组用于开发安卓应用程序的工具和库。通过配置好这些环境,就可以开始进行安卓开发了。

三、基本概念

在熟悉开发环境之后,需要掌握安卓开发中的一些基本概念。其中最重要的概念之一是Activity,它是安卓应用程序的一个组件,负责处理用户界面的展示和交互。还有Fragment、Service、Broadcast Receiver等组件,它们分别用于实现应用程序的不同功能。了解布局和控件也是开发过程中必不可少的一部分。布局用于定义界面的结构和样式,而控件则用于实现用户交互。通过熟悉这些基本概念,可以为后续的应用程序开发打下坚实的基础。

四、开发流程

在掌握了基本概念之后,可以开始进行安卓应用程序的开发。开发过程可以简单概括为以下几个步骤:需要设计应用程序的界面,确定用户界面的结构和样式。根据设计好的界面,编写相应的代码,实现界面中的各种功能。在编写代码的过程中,可以使用Android Studio提供的模板和工具来简化开发过程。编写完代码之后,可以进行调试和测试,确保应用程序的功能和界面正常运行。可以将应用程序发布到安卓应用商店或其他渠道,供用户下载和使用。

五、进阶技巧

除了基本的开发知识和流程,想要成为安卓开发的专家还需要掌握一些进阶技巧。其中之一是性能优化,通过合理地使用资源、优化算法和代码结构等方式,提高应用程序的性能和响应速度。对于不同的安卓设备和屏幕分辨率的适配也是一个重要的技巧。在开发过程中,还可以利用第三方库和开源项目来加快开发效率和拓展应用程序的功能。通过不断学习和实践,不断提升自己的技能和经验,才能在安卓开发领域中达到精通的水平。

六、总结

安卓开发从入门到精通需要掌握Java编程语言、了解安卓开发的基本概念和流程,熟悉开发环境和工具,掌握一些进阶技巧。通过不断学习和实践,提升自己的技能和经验,才能成为一名优秀的安卓开发者。通过本文的介绍,希望读者能够对安卓开发有一个初步的认识,并为进一步深入学习和实践提供一些指导和帮助。

安卓开发程序培训班:打开你的技术之门

一、安卓开发的意义

在如今智能手机普及的时代,安卓系统已经成为了移动应用开发的首选平台。而安卓开发程序培训班则为学习者提供了一个系统学习安卓开发的机会。它不仅能够帮助你开发出属于自己的应用程序,还能让你深入了解技术背后的原理和实现方式。

二、培训班的课程设置

安卓开发程序培训班的课程设置非常全面。从最基础的安卓开发环境搭建开始,到实际项目的开发和发布,每个环节都有专门的课程来指导学员。而在课程设计上,培训班注重理论与实践相结合,以案例和项目实战为主线,让学员在动手实践中深入了解每个知识点。

三、培训班的优势

安卓开发程序培训班有许多值得称赞的优势。培训班的师资力量雄厚,拥有经验丰富的讲师团队,可以提供专业的指导和解答学员的问题。培训班还提供了一些实际项目合作的机会,让学员在实战中提升自己的开发能力。培训班注重培养学员的解决问题的能力和创新思维,而不仅仅是教授技术的使用。

四、培训班的前景和发展趋势

随着安卓市场的不断扩大,对安卓开发人才的需求也在不断增长。选择参加安卓开发程序培训班将是一个明智的选择。培训班不仅可以帮助你掌握安卓开发的核心技术,还可以提供就业和创业的机会。虽然竞争激烈,但只要你具备了扎实的技术基础和创新能力,就能够在这个行业中脱颖而出。

五、结语

安卓开发程序培训班是一扇开启技术之门的机会。通过参加培训班,你将掌握安卓开发的核心技术,拥有开发出属于自己的应用程序的能力。培训班还能够提供就业和创业的机会,为你的未来发展铺平道路。不要犹豫了,赶快加入安卓开发程序培训班,开启你的技术之门吧!